Output 42e86b079f51434f546195bbf2487ef0d01052eb4a8be24e15dba957c6a2b5d9:15

value
20616651
script pubkey
OP_0 OP_PUSHBYTES_32 ad4aac2b6d398ebe56bb82880f96400bcb096e486ceb9e986778c2edf349a0de
address
bc1q4492c2md8x8tu44ms2yql9jqp09sjmjgdn4eaxr80rpwmu6f5r0qmx3ha3
transaction
42e86b079f51434f546195bbf2487ef0d01052eb4a8be24e15dba957c6a2b5d9
confirmations
121463
spent
true